⚡ In a Rush? Key Takeaways
- Microwave heats milk to drinking temp in 45-60s, vs 3-4min on stove.
- Costs £0.006 per 250ml vs £0.08-0.12 for gas hob.
- Ideal temp: 60-65°C (140-149°F), avoid exceeding 77°C (170°F).
- ✅ Use 70% power, stir at 30s mark to prevent ‘bumping’.
